I recently tried some free demos PNW & iceland. Previously ftx global had been working fine. Now I am seeing trees in the water and water in the trees all over fsx. I installed the patch for ftx global (although when ftx central loads it still says version 1.0) and the latest libraries. When I go to ftx central I have two options global and north america. The default option does not appear at all. When I switched from north america back to global I got the error below. I have removed the iceland demo, but I got an error when running the pnw uninstaller and it was not removed. I have moved my airport scenery about all ftx products and it does not solve the issue. I was thinking about uninstalling ftx and deleting any orbx file on my computer and then trying to reinstall it. Thanks.

pls try this

go to => C:\ProgramData\Microsoft\FSX and open the scenery.cfg file with notepad and check that the first entry is equal to the one I've posted here

[Area.001]

Title=Default Terrain

Local=Scenery\World

Texture_ID=1

Layer=1

Active=TRUE

Required=TRUE

The very first entry is:[General]

Title=FS9 World Scenery
Description=FS9 Scenery Data
Clean_on_Exit=TRUE
 
Right after that is the entry you posted and it matches exactly. I don't have fs9 only fsx.
